ABSTRACT

The study investigated the appraisal of financial statement in evaluating organizational performance of banks. The major objective of the study is to examine the effect of financial statement in evaluating organizational performance of banks and to ascertain the effect of profit after tax on the return on capital employed of banks. To achieve the objectives of the study, ex pose factor research design was adopted. The researcher adopted secondary data in getting the required information. In testing the hypothesis simple linear regression analysis was used. The findings revealed that liquidity has a positive impact on profit after tax and that there is no significant relationship between profit after tax and return on capital employed. The researcher recommended that the financial ratio analysis should be properly appraised in banks in other for the management to identi)5' the strength and weakness inherent in the system as the serves as performance indicator, the researcher also recommended that the financial statement should be prepared and presented in such a way to aid proper and accurate comparison.
